Publisher Description: Traditional Chinese medicine is perhaps the oldest system of health care in the world--and one of the safest and most effective. This first easy-to-use pocket guide provides everything readers need to know to explore Chinese herbal medicine for themselves. The book includes: - A brief overview of the basic terms and concepts of traditional Chinese medicine. - Simple instructions on how to prepare herbal formulas at home. - An illustrated guide to 108 of the most widely used Chinese herbs, with descriptions, therapeutic effects, preparation methods, and dosages. - A guide to dozens of readily available prepared herbal formulas for common ailments. - An index of symptoms and ailments. - Listings of mail-order houses for herbs, herbal formulas, and other supplies. - Suggestions for further reading. |
